题目大意: 将一串数字分成许多子串,输出每串的代价是子串数和的平方加常数M。求代价最小值。 首先DP是毫无疑问的,但是直接搞药丸,时间复杂度过高,那该怎么优化呢? 这时候,就该使用斜率优化了。 不多说,先列出DP方程:\(d{p_i} = \mathop {\min }\limits_{j < i} ...
分类:
其他好文 时间:
2017-09-22 22:30:02
阅读次数:
99
使用c3p0连接池来改版JdbcUtils工具 1. 使用c3p0连接池获取连接,使代码更加简单 2. 在src路径下必须给出c3p0-config.xml配置文件 3. 总结 * 什么是连接池 连接池是装有连接的容器,使用连接的话,可以从连接池中进行获取,使用完成之后将连接归还给连接池。 * 为什 ...
分类:
数据库 时间:
2017-09-22 17:57:55
阅读次数:
205
1、模糊查询 通过模糊查询,查找相关数据: db.test.find({name:/joe/}) 查询name字段含有joe的数据 等同于db.test.find({name:{$regex:'joe'}}) db.test.find({name:/joe/i}) 加了i,那么就不会区分大小写,都会 ...
分类:
数据库 时间:
2017-09-22 17:52:19
阅读次数:
199
链接:http://www.lydsy.com/JudgeOnline/problem.php?id=1584 题意:找到某种分割序列方法,使得每一段中所含数的种类平方之和最小。 考试时一时脑残连暴力$dp$都没写出来…… 首先暴力dp应该都写得出来……$f[i]=min(f[j]+(cnt[j~i ...
分类:
其他好文 时间:
2017-09-22 17:46:37
阅读次数:
126
摘要: 1.最小二乘法 2.梯度下降法 3.最大(对数)似然估计(MLE) 4.最大后验估计(MAP) 5.期望最大化算法(EM) 6.牛顿法 7.拟牛顿迭代(BFGS) 8.限制内存-拟牛顿迭代(L-BFGS) 9.深度学习中的梯度优化算法 10.各种最优化方法比较 拟牛顿法和牛顿法区别,哪个收敛 ...
分类:
其他好文 时间:
2017-09-22 16:34:16
阅读次数:
211
From:https://developer.nvidia.com/content/redundancy-and-latency-structured-buffer-use In a recent post, we discussed a simple pothole that developers ...
分类:
其他好文 时间:
2017-09-22 15:34:44
阅读次数:
130
CSS不能编程?用Less、Sass、Stylus、甚至直接用 Absurd,框架除了Bootstrap还有很多。JS写多了很麻烦?jQuery。移动开发?Zepto.js。结构不好?找框架,Backbone.js是MVC,AngularJS和Ember.js是MVVM,Twitter还弄了个事件驱 ...
分类:
其他好文 时间:
2017-09-22 13:03:14
阅读次数:
114
在处理业务的时候,有时候需要根据情况使用不同的线程处理模型来处理业务逻辑,这里演示一下常见的线程模型使用技巧。 1、Future模型 前面的章节中提到过Future模型,该模型通常在使用的时候需要结合Callable接口配合使用。Future:未来的、将来的,再结合Callable大概可以明白其功能 ...
分类:
编程语言 时间:
2017-09-22 12:05:49
阅读次数:
230
1 $arr[$j]){ 47 $min = $arr[$j]; 48 $min_index = $j; 49 } 50 } 51 52 if($min_index == $i){ 53 continue; 54 } 55 56 ... ...
分类:
编程语言 时间:
2017-09-22 10:17:08
阅读次数:
182
效果图 <!DOCTYPE html><html> <head> <meta charset="utf-8" /> <title></title> <script type="text/javascript" src="js/jquery-1.11.1.min.js" ></script> <sty ...
分类:
其他好文 时间:
2017-09-22 01:03:24
阅读次数:
159